Learner's definition of DUD
[count] : something that does not do what it is supposed to do : something that is a complete failure不中用的东西;彻底失败的事
duds [plural] informal : clothes衣服

Learner's definition of DUD
always used before a noun
used to describe something that fails completely or does not work properly不中用的;出故障的
